The Beauty and Utility of Gray and White Gravel
Gray and white gravel has increasingly become a favored landscaping material, celebrated for its versatility and elegant aesthetic appeal. Used in various applications, from driveways and pathways to decorative garden features, this type of gravel provides both practical benefits and visual charm. The inherent qualities of gray and white gravel make it an ideal choice for homeowners and landscape designers alike.
One of the most attractive aspects of gray and white gravel is its striking color palette. The subtle variations in shades—from the cool tones of pale gray to the pristine brightness of pure white—contribute to a clean and contemporary look. This color combination can complement a broad range of building materials, including wood, brick, and stone. Whether used in a modern garden or a rustic setting, gray and white gravel seamlessly integrates into various design themes, lending an air of sophistication and permanence to outdoor spaces.
In terms of functionality, gray and white gravel offers numerous advantages. It serves as a fantastic drainage solution for landscaping projects, effectively preventing water accumulation. Landscapers often utilize gravel to create paths that allow rainwater to permeate the ground, reducing runoff and promoting healthy plant growth. This property is particularly beneficial in regions prone to heavy rainfall, where standing water can cause detrimental erosion and flooding.
Moreover, the durability of gray and white gravel makes it a long-lasting option for various applications. Unlike grass, which requires constant maintenance, or concrete, which can crack and deteriorate over time, gravel remains resilient with minimal upkeep. A properly installed layer of gravel can withstand wear and tear while retaining its aesthetic appeal for years. This makes it a cost-effective alternative for driveways and garden paths, where both functionality and aesthetics are necessary.
In addition to practical uses, gray and white gravel is an excellent medium for creating visually appealing features in outdoor spaces. Designers often employ it in Zen gardens, where the contrast between the gravel and the surrounding plants fosters a sense of tranquility. The smooth texture of the stones enhances the tactile experience of the garden, inviting visitors to engage with their surroundings. Furthermore, when combined with different elements—such as rocks, plants, and water features—gray and white gravel can create striking focal points that draw the eye and evoke a sense of harmony.
Another aspect to consider is the eco-friendliness of gray and white gravel. As a natural material, it is an environmentally sustainable choice compared to synthetic alternatives. It promotes natural drainage, which reduces runoff and the associated environmental consequences. For those seeking to create sustainable gardens, using gravel can also contribute to xeriscaping efforts. By covering the soil with gravel, gardeners can minimize the need for irrigation while still suppressing weed growth, ultimately conserving water.
Furthermore, working with gray and white gravel allows for creativity in design. Homeowners can choose from different sizes and shapes—including flat stones and rounded pebbles—to create unique textures and patterns. By incorporating borders or pathways, gravel can be easily shaped to fit specific layouts or to highlight certain areas of a garden. This flexibility in design can cater to different personal tastes and the specific needs of outdoor spaces.
In conclusion, gray and white gravel stands out as a remarkable material for landscaping due to its combination of beauty, functionality, and sustainability. Whether used as a practical solution for drainage, a decorative element in a garden, or a durable surface for pathways, it provides an ideal option for enhancing outdoor spaces. The natural elegance of gray and white gravel not only contributes to the aesthetics of a property but also supports eco-friendly practices that benefit both the environment and the community. As landscape design continues to evolve, gray and white gravel remains a timeless choice, beautifully marrying form and function in numerous applications.
